I have a 1973 350B sixway blade and rippers. Reveres-er works fine for a while then seems to stop working. It seems to be temperature related. For the first few hours of running the machine in 80 degree weather it works as designed. Then when you shift from forward to reverse nothing happens. I push the clutch and release it the machine moves fine. Any thoughts

Hi,

The clutch pedal does not operate a clutch disc - it operates a hydraulic valve which dumps pressure which stops the reverser operation. Sounds like you have a problem with that valve.
